Do you have a struggling reader in the house.  Instead of having the child read a story, that they may not be interested, try writing the instructions out for making popcorn, mac and cheese, or any other simple food.  In the beginning you may have to shadow read with your child, but as they can read a word by themselves, underline it.  The idea being that the more words they can read by themselves, and therefore underline, the better they will feel about themselves, and therefore develop greater self confidence.
